logo

Output 66f768fb2b70be91b8f114557f40ba7aa29d4d5915f82308725aa1e88ab26e0b:0

value
530212408
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 856e36c6a2189b8c420bb99f0c79b3d5946dc735 OP_EQUALVERIFY OP_CHECKSIG
address
1DAWuKE3DeGkNL9rniG3FA5MH6nQHwfhD3
transaction
66f768fb2b70be91b8f114557f40ba7aa29d4d5915f82308725aa1e88ab26e0b